Prime Minister Narendra Modi is trailing from his Varanasi Seat, according to the official website of the Election Commission of India (ECI), as the counting of votes for Lok Sabha Election 2024 is underway. Congress candidate Ajay Rai has taken the massive lead of over 6,200 votes against PM Modi. The counting of votes for Lok Sabha Elections 2024 started at 8 am on Tuesday morning. The Lok Sabha Elections 2024 Results will be declared this evening. Varanasi polled on June 1 in the last phase of the Lok Sabha Elections 2024. In 2019, PM Modi secured a comfortable win for the second time - the first being in 2014.
